Wudu step 1: The intention (Niyyah)
1
Step 1

The intention (Niyyah)

It all begins in your heart before touching the water.

The intention is made in the heart, not with the tongue. Prepare to purify yourself for Allah, then simply say "Bismillah" before starting.

Understanding wudu

How do you perform wudu in Islam?

Minor ablution, known as wudu, prepares a Muslim for prayer. Men and women follow the same essential steps: make the intention, wash each part in order and ensure the water reaches every specified area.
